Madras Coffee House has over 120 branches across the globe, this branch in Chennai is a nostalgic gem that effortlessly blends tradition with taste. Nestled in the heart of the city, this iconic spot is a must-visit for coffee lovers and anyone wanting to experience authentic South Indian filter coffee in its purest form. The star of the menu is, of course, the degree filter coffee—strong, aromatic, and perfectly balanced with frothy milk served piping hot in a traditional dabara-tumbler. It’s easily one of the best filter coffees in Chennai, brewed with just the right amount of chicory for that rich, earthy flavor. Beyond coffee, the menu offers a diverse range of beverages, including fragrant teas, cooling buttermilk, rejuvenating nannaari sarbath, invigorating green tea, and luscious badam milk, a delightful variety of South Indian tiffin items including idli, vada, pongal, upma, dosas, and poori masala, all freshly made and served with coconut chutney and sambar. Their masala dosa is a standout—crispy on the outside with a generous, flavorful potato filling. The kesari and rava kichdi are comfort foods that hit the spot, especially when paired with coffee. For a light snack, don’t miss their samosas, cutlets, and medu vadas, which are always crisp and not overly oily. They also offer fresh fruit juices, tea, and badam milk for those looking for alternatives to coffee. The ambiance is simple, clean, and steeped in old-world charm, giving off a nostalgic vibe reminiscent of Chennai's café culture from the 70s and 80s. The staff are polite and service is quick, making it an ideal place for a quick breakfast or a relaxed coffee break. Overall, Madras Coffee House is not just a café—it’s an experience.
